LAS CRUCES, N.M. – With one week remaining before the start of regular season action, the Aggies took to the field at the NM State Soccer Athletic Complex for an exhibition with Cochise College on Thursday night.
CUSA Preseason Offensive Player of the Year
Loma McNeese tallied multiple goals to lead the NM State scoring attack on the night, while fellow CUSA Preseason Team member
Bianca Chacon scored and assisted on the night.
The Aggies rotated through the three goalies currently on the roster:
Valerie Guha,
Karolanne Lafortune and
Diana Martinez, as they look to replace two extremely talented goalkeepers in
Makenna Gottschalk and Dmitri Fong. Along with the trio, every player who entered the match played at least 13 minutes, including a game-high 61 minutes for sophomore forward
Meredith Scott.
"Preseason has been extremely tough." Said Head Coach
Rob Baarts after the match. "So I think finally getting out and playing and building our way through all the emotion we've been through was very difficult, and I'm super proud of all of them."
UP NEXT
NM State kicks off its season with a road match against the Portland State Vikings on Thursday August 17
th from Portland, Oregon. The Aggies make the trek to the Rose City after the Vikings came to Las Cruces in the 2022 season – a 3-0 victory for the Crimson & White. Kick off is set for 7 p.m. MT.
